Background
The infusion solution or large-volume injection solution is a large-volume injection solution which is infused into the body by intravenous drip, is administered by more than 100ml at one time, is a branch of the injection solution, is usually packaged in a glass or plastic infusion bottle or bag, does not contain bacteriostatic agent, is hung on the infusion support when in use, and continuously and stably infuses the medicine into the body by adjusting the infusion speed through the infusion apparatus.
The existing infusion support does not have an alarm function, medical staff and patients cannot be warned before liquid input in an infusion bottle is about to end, the use convenience of the infusion support is reduced, and therefore the infusion moving support with the alarm function is provided.

Detailed Description
The following describes embodiments of the present invention with reference to the drawings.
Example (b):
as shown in fig. 1-4, the utility model discloses a take alarming function's infusion to remove frame, including support frame 1, the surface swing joint of support frame 1 has adjustable shelf 2, fixed surface is connected with connecting rod 4 on the adjustable shelf 2, the surface swing joint of connecting rod 4 has mounted frame 3, the equal fixedly connected with connecting block 6 in both ends of mounted frame 3, internal surface threaded connection of connecting block 6 has telescopic link 8, the one end fixedly connected with of telescopic link 8 draws piece 9, the other end fixedly connected with knob 5 of telescopic link 8, the last surface swing joint who draws piece 9 has second reset spring 21, the outside of 8 outer surface lower extremes of telescopic link is provided with hanger block 7, the last fixed surface of hanger block 7 is connected with metal block 10, the lower fixed surface of connecting block 6 is connected with contact block 11, the outer fixed surface of connecting block 6 is connected with siren 12, the outer fixed surface of hanger block 7 is connected with couple 13.
The working principle of the technical scheme is as follows:
when the device is used, firstly, a hanging bottle is hung on the hook 13, at the moment, the hanging block 7 is driven to move downwards through the hook 13 under the self weight of the hanging bottle, then the hanging block 7 compresses the second return spring 21 on the upper surface of the pull block 9 and enables the second return spring to be stressed, then the knob 5 is rotated to drive the telescopic rod 8 to rotate, the telescopic rod 8 and the hanging block 7 slightly move upwards until the hanging block 7 is restored to the original position, the contact block 11 can be in contact with the metal block 10, when solution in the hanging bottle is gradually reduced, the pressure born by the second return spring 21 is reduced, the hanging block 7 can slowly move upwards until the contact block 11 is in contact with the metal block 10, at the moment, the alarm 12 is electrified to give an alarm, meanwhile, the rotation of the telescopic rod 8 can be controlled through the knob 5, the height of the hanging block 7 is controlled, the hanging block 7 and the metal block 10 are lowered when the device is not used, the hanging block 7 is adjusted to a proper position when the device is used, and the alarm function is conveniently provided for the device.
In another embodiment, as shown in fig. 3 and 4, a bearing block 14 is connected to an outer surface of the supporting frame 1 through a screw thread, a handle 15 is fixedly connected to an outer surface of the bearing block 14, a sliding groove 16 is formed in an outer wall of the supporting frame 1, a sliding block 19 is fixedly connected to an inner wall of the movable frame 2, a first return spring 17 is fixedly connected to an inner surface of the suspension frame 3, a clamping block 18 is fixedly connected to a lower surface of the first return spring 17, and a clamping groove 20 is formed in an upper surface of the movable frame 2.
When the device is used, the angle of the suspension bracket 3 and the overall height of the device can be adjusted, when the angle of the connecting rod 4 is adjusted, the suspension bracket 3 is directly pulled to control the suspension bracket 3 to rotate on the outer surface of the connecting rod 4, the clamping block 18 can be pressed by the upper surface of the movable bracket 2 to move towards the suspension bracket 3, the first reset spring 17 is compressed to enable the clamping block to bear force until the clamping block 18 is clamped into the other clamping groove 20, when the height is adjusted, the bearing block 14 is controlled to rotate on the outer surface of the support frame 1 through the handle 15, the height of the bearing block 14 on the outer surface of the support frame 1 is adjusted, then the movable bracket 2 can be always attached to the upper surface of the bearing block 14 under the self gravity, and the use angle of the suspension bracket 3 and the height of the device can be adjusted conveniently.
In another embodiment, as shown in the figure, a power supply is arranged inside the connecting block 6, and the power supply is electrically connected with the alarm 12 and the contact block 11.
The power supply inside the connection block 6 is used to power the alarm 12 and then to close the circuit in the contact between the contact block 11 and the metal block 10, facilitating the control of the operation of the alarm 12.
In another embodiment, as shown in fig. 2, an indicating groove is formed at the upper end of the outer surface of the telescopic rod 8, and the upper end of the second return spring 21 is fixedly connected with the inner wall of the hanging block 7.
The indicating groove on the telescopic rod 8 is used for indicating the maximum height of the hanging block 7 required by the alarm 12 to start when the hook 13 does not hang heavy objects.
In another embodiment, as shown in fig. 1 and 3, the latch 18 and the latch slot 20 are matched, and the slider 19 and the slide slot 16 are matched.
The movable frame 2 slides in the sliding groove 16 through the sliding block 19, so that the movable frame 2 is prevented from rotating when the height is adjusted, and the clamping block 18 and the clamping groove 20 are used for limiting the rotation of the suspension frame 3 to a certain extent.
In another embodiment, as shown in fig. 1 and 4, the movable frame 2 and the upper surface of the bearing block 14 are attached to each other, and the handle 15 is movably connected to the supporting frame 1 through the bearing block 14.
The bearing block 14 attached to the movable frame 2 supports the movable frame 2 through the bearing block 14, and then the height of the bearing block 14 is adjusted to further adjust the height of the movable frame 2, so that the use height of the control device is convenient.
In another embodiment, as shown in fig. 1 and 3, the movable frame 2 and the suspension frame 3 are movably connected by a connecting rod 4, and the lower surface of the suspension frame 3 and the upper surface of the movable frame 2 are in contact with each other.
The suspension bracket 3 contacted with the movable bracket 2 is convenient for clamping the clamping block 18 into the clamping groove 20 and keeping the connection between the suspension bracket 3 and the movable bracket 2 under the action of the connecting rod 4.
